Narahara Station is on the Kishin Line, 66.4 km from Himeji, in the city of Mimasaka, Okayama Prefecture, and is operated by JR West. It opened on 1 October 1954 as a new stop between Mimasaka-Emi and Hayashino on the JNR Kishin Line. Operations passed to JR West with the 1987 JNR privatization. The simple-commission staffing arrangement ended on 1 April 2011, leaving the station fully unstaffed. The station has a single side platform with no station building.
